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
951 18096732 804126560 60445450443
12 750052 0677170352
12 750052 0677170352
282130 085302 283056
All about undefined
Interested in learning more?
12 750052 0677170352
282130 085302 283056
See more
94018045 8259819173
0819914099 7045412381 93899125
See more
50224 061119896 3346318
0351217680 168811 548 7769 222
See more